Alaska Payroll Employment By County for The Federal Government Trade Transportation And Utilities Industry in September, 2021
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in September, 2021, Alaska added 31 number of jobs to the federal government trade, transportation, and utilities industry. Among Alaska counties, Anchorage added the highest number of jobs (26), followed by Fairbanks North Star (6), and Bethel (3).
